Can you restore a SharePoint Portal Server 2003 backup to a MOSS farm? No.

Published Tuesday, October 21, 2008 1:57 PM

If you try to restore a SPD file from SharePoint 2003 to a MOSS instance, you will get this error:


Your backup is from a different version of Windows SharePoint Services and cannot be restored to a server running the current version. The backup file should be restored to a server with version '6.0.2.8117' or later.

if the wss 2.0 database is atleast at sp2 you can connect it from the stsadm command on MOSS using addcontentdb. this will do an upgrade of the database and pending any issues and should come out ok and connected to MOSS unless you have made major modifications to wss 2.0 that MOSS does not understand.
